Abstract

Official abstract text for this publication.

The invention relates to a crystal fiber, a Raman spectrometer using the same and a inspection method thereof. The crystal fiber comprises a sapphire crystal is doped with two transition metals having different concentrations. An excitation light beam at a specific wavelength can propagate along the crystal fiber to generate a narrow-band light beam and a wide-band light beam to project on a specimen. Raman scattered light is emitted from the specimen. The wavelength of the Raman scattered light falls within the wavelength range of the wide-band light beam so that the wide-band light beam is enhanced at some characteristic wavelengths to facilitate Raman spectroscopy.

First claim

Opening claim text (preview).

What is claimed is: 1. A crystal fiber, comprising: a sapphire crystal having a core, the core comprising a first transition metal and a second transition metal, wherein the concentration of said first transition metal is different from the concentration of said second transition metal, whereby said first and said second transition metals generate a narrow-band light beam and a wide-band light beam simultaneously when an excitation light passes through said crystal fiber.…
